Definition
This expression means that a task, problem, or issue has been finished or resolved, and nothing more needs to be done.
Usage & Nuances
This phrase is informal and often said after finishing a task, sometimes with satisfaction or relief. Common when wrapping up small jobs or solving minor issues. It can sometimes imply something was resolved easily or completely.
